Bomba Shack Moon Event
Bomba's bar was built piecemeal on the coastline from thrown out surf boards, driftwood and corrugated tin. It's embellished with graffiti and a collection of underwears and bras given away by guests who lower their inhibitions under the lunar radiance.
Full Moon Parties are popular in the BVI, and you may encounter one during your cruise or yacht charter. This short article will focus on the well-known party at Bomba Shack on Tortola.

Bomba's Shack, a true shack constructed of driftwood, utility pole and busted surf boards, is an enjoyable area where the bartender pours hallucinogenic tea and you can rub shoulders with locals and travelers.
It could be easy to obtain switched off by the shack's style of images of visitors with Bomba and bras and underwears that hang from the ceiling, however it is an excellent location to celebration. In 1989, Bomba started holding Full Moon celebrations and the tradition has stuck.
Other beach bars, such as Cocomaya on Virgin Gorda and Foxy's Taboo on Jost Van Dyke, currently host Moon events also.
